Biography
Dr. Jindong Zhang is currently working in the Department of Department of Fisheries and Wildlife, Michigan State University, East Lansing, United States of America. His research interests includes Animal Communications, Zoology and Forest Conservation. He is serving as an editorial member and reviewer of several international reputed journals. Dr. Jindong Zhang is the member of many international affiliations. He has successfully completed his Administrative responsibilities. He has authored of many research articles/books related to Animal Communications and Zoology.
Research Interest
Animal Communications, Zoology, Forest Conservation, Silviculture, Camera Trapping, Conservation Biology, Wildlife Conservation, Conservation, Wildlife Biology and Wildlife Ecology.
